Subject: genirq: Fix incorrect check for forced IRQ thread handler

We do not want a bitwise AND between boolean operands

diff --git a/kernel/irq/manage.c b/kernel/irq/manage.c
index a9a9dbe..c0730ad 100644
--- a/kernel/irq/manage.c
+++ b/kernel/irq/manage.c
@@ -773,7 +773,7 @@ static int irq_thread(void *data)
                        struct irqaction *action);
        int wake;
 
-       if (force_irqthreads & test_bit(IRQTF_FORCED_THREAD,
+       if (force_irqthreads && test_bit(IRQTF_FORCED_THREAD,
                                        &action->thread_flags))
                handler_fn = irq_forced_thread_fn;
        else
